For industrial tenants, screening involves assessing the business's credibility, understanding their operational needs and potential environmental impact, verifying necessary licenses, and securing appropriate security deposits or guarantees commensurate with the lease value and potential risks involved.
An essential component of TENANT SCREENING PEENYA, BANGALURU for industrial properties involves assessing the proposed tenant's operational plan and its potential impact on the property and surroundings – understanding the type of machinery to be used, raw materials involved, expected workforce size, vehicle movement frequency, waste generation levels, and potential noise or pollution factors helps landlords evaluate compatibility with the property's infrastructure, zoning regulations, and neighborhood context before finalizing industrial leases.
A key aspect of TENANT SCREENING PEENYA, BANGALURU for industrial tenants involves assessing their operational track record and reputation – checking their history regarding environmental compliance, labor practices, financial stability (through credit reports or references), adherence to lease terms in previous locations, and ensuring their proposed activity aligns with the property's infrastructure capacity and zoning permissions minimizes risks for landlords leasing valuable industrial assets in Peenya.
